Infinite Automation Systems Inc. has signed a very exciting licensing agreement with DGLogik Inc. to use their DGLux data visualization platform with all the Mango M2M and Mango Automation Products.
DGLux at a powerful, drag and drop, graphic generation tool to create visually stunning and dynamic dashboards using real time and historical data from the Mango products.
The two products now combined together make one of the most powerful SCADA and HMI / Remote Monitoring solution you will find.
DGLux will be included in every licensed version of Mango Automation (not released yet) at no extra charge and for a limited time we will also offer DGLux integration and licensing for existing Mango M2M Users. We actually have an iphone, ipad, and Android app coming out soon which makes rendering really perfect. With DGlux you can also design the dashboard for interaction with mobile gestures and screen resolution detection which make it a perfect tool for mobile viewing. Even without the app you can view dashboards from android devices pretty well but being flash based you need the app to view on iphones or ipads.

DGLux has it's own licensing. You can request a 30 day trial which will have 5 available dashboards. In the license request box just put the word Trial in the project name. It might take a hour or more but it will then be automatically licensed.
